SANTINO CONGRATULATES GLUCK & FIVE TOWNS AUXILIARY POLICE

Town of Hempstead Senior Councilman Anthony J. Santino and Nassau County Police Department officials joined together to congratulate the Five Towns Auxiliary Unit of the Nassau County Police Department.

Led by Deputy Inspector Danny Gluck, the unit is made up of dedicated and civic-minded neighbors who take and pass rigorous courses given by the Police Department so that they may work to help improve the level of safety in the community.

At the 32nd Annual Longevity & Service Awards and Promotion Ceremony, several members of the Auxiliary Unit were honored for their continued commitment to our neighbors.
